New York Payroll Taxes The state as a whole has a progressive income tax that ranges from 4.00% to 8.82%, depending on an employee's income level. There is also a supplemental withholding rate of 9.62% for bonuses and commissions. In New York state, an employee's tax burden can also vary based on location.

What is federal payroll tax rate 2020?
For 2020, the Social Security tax rate is 6.2% on the first $137,700 of wages paid. The Medicare tax rate is 1.45% on the first $200,000 of wages (plus an additional 0.9% for wages above $200,000).

What is the federal payroll tax rate for 2020?
For 2020, maximum taxable earnings are $137,700.
Employers and employees each contribute 6.2 percent of the workers' wages for a combined 12.4 percent—10.6 percent for the OASI trust fund (retirement and survivors) and 1.8 percent for the DI trust fund (disability)..

What is the NYS income tax rate for 2020?
New York Income Tax Rate 2019 - 2020. New York state income tax rate table for the 2019 - 2020 filing season has eight income tax brackets with NY tax rates of 4%, 4.5%, 5.25%, 5.9%, 6.21%, 6.49%, 6.85% and 8.82% for Single, Married Filing Jointly, Married Filing Separately, and Head of Household statuses.

ProfessorWhat is payroll tax rate 2020?
Not to be confused with the federal income tax, FICA taxes fund the Social Security and Medicare programs and add up to 7.65% of your pay (in 2020). The breakdown for the two taxes is 6.2% for Social Security (on wages up to $137,700) and 1.45% for Medicare (plus an additional 0.90% for wages in excess of $200,000).

GuestIs unemployment taxed at the same rate as regular income?
The Basics Money you receive as an unemployment benefit is considered to be “income.” Therefore, it is usually subject to the same tax requirements as income. However, unemployment is not subject to “payroll taxes,” which include the taxes for Social Security and Medicare that are usually withheld from your paycheck.

GuestWhat is the sales tax rate in New York City?
4.5%New York City Sales Tax On top of the state sales tax, New York City has a sales tax of 4.5%. The city also collects a tax of 0.375% because it is within the MCTD. The total sales tax in New York City is 8.875%. This is the highest rate in the state.
